cat chasing mouse whirligig

Cat chasing a mouse whirligig.


This is a play on an older design I came up with in the 70's The older design has the cat in a more upright position and the mouse is mostly cut out of wood.

My original 1998 version. 4th generation at that time and as you can see changes are always on going. The bottom round was for display only and was designed to be mounted on fence post. The eyes were animal doll eyes for the cat. The mouse eyes were plastic google eyes and the tail pipe cleaner.

Witch whirligig weathervane

Holloween witch and cat whirligig weather vain





The following photo is how the unfinished assembled product should approximately look.
The above diagram is not an exact copy of the photo below and modifications to the pattern have been made. Note; the propeller blades need to be set at an angle in order for them to work. I would also recommend making the broom of the broom stick larger to act more as a rudder in the wind.

This following photo is of a finished hanging witch whirligig . The colors you paint it is up to you. I change the design each time I make one so no two are the same.
